International Melon Festival officially opens in Khiva

The prestigious event, organised at the Ichan-Kala complex and the Arda Khiva tourist complex, is attended by Jurabek Rakhimov, Khokim of the Khorezm Region; Abdulaziz Akkulov, Chairman of the Tourism Committee of the Republic of Uzbekistan; heads of government agencies; members of the diplomatic corps; representatives of international and domestic tourism organisations; agricultural specialists; farmers; international guests; and media representatives.
It was noted that in recent years Uzbekistan has placed particular emphasis on developing tourism as a strategic sector of the national economy. Extensive efforts are underway to enhance the tourism appeal of the country’s ancient cities, particularly Khiva, develop modern tourism infrastructure, and create new tourism products.
As part of the International Melon Festival, visitors can explore exhibitions featuring melons and other melon crops, enjoy presentations of traditional national dishes, visit folk crafts fairs, and attend concert programmes, cultural performances, and various competitions. Over the course of several days, the festival will offer local residents and international visitors a vibrant and memorable experience.
One of the festival’s highlights will be a concert by renowned Russian singer MakSim, to be held at the Arda Khiva tourist complex on 8 August. Admission to the concert is free.
Participants who demonstrate outstanding activity during the International Melon Festival will receive valuable prizes from the Khorezm Regional Administration and sponsors in various categories.
